HPE Aruba Networking CX 10000 Switch Series, industry's first DPU-enabled switches, delivers a flexible and innovative approach to address the security performance, agility, and scalability demands of both traditional enterprise data centers and emerging distributed, edge and co-located centers of data. The switch series is a category of switches that combines the best-of-breed network operating system, HPE Aruba Networking CX Switch Operating System (AOS-CX), for data center, campus, and edge in addition to the fully programmable DPUs. This allows the switches to deliver software-defined services inline, at scale, with wire-rate performance and orders of magnitude scale and performance improvements over traditional L2/L3 switches at a fraction of their TCO. This allows the flexibility to enable service delivery, when deployed as access, leaf top-of-rack (ToR), or end-of-row (EoR) in a data center, and potentially in the aggregation layer in campus or edge data center designs.

A category of distributed services switch with embedded programmable DPUs overcoming legacy network and security design limitations
Security ecosystem integration with third-party vendors
Leverage existing AOS-CX cloud-native switching
CX 10000 offer 3.2 Tbps of switching capacity supporting 1/10/25GbE CX 10040 offer 8 Tbps of switching capacity supporting 32 x 100G, 6 x 400G connectivity
Unified network and security policy through HPE Aruba Networking Fabric Composer
Distributed stateful segmentation, east–west firewalling, NAT, encryption, and telemetry services — all delivered inline
